Instead of just holding cash in Euros, it is better to invest in European stocks that trade in Euros. That way, you don't just keep up with how the Euro is beating the dollar, but you also keep up with any inflation in euro-land.

Note: I'm not saying that the Euro will continue to dominate the dollar -- do your own research and make your own bet. All I'm saying it is better to invest in good companies in the country/regio you are in than to just hold the currency as cash. Do the research and pick some good companies and/or a good index fund.
